Area contextNeighborhood Overview – Austin BUS & Entrepreneurship Hs (Chicago, IL)
Austin Business and Entrepreneurship High School is situated in Chicago's West Side, specifically within the Austin neighborhood. This location offers a blend of urban convenience and community feel, with major thoroughfares like North Pine Avenue and West Chicago Avenue providing direct access to the wider city. Getting to the school typically involves navigating Chicago's grid system; expect moderate to heavy traffic, especially during peak commute hours. Public transportation is a strong option, with numerous CTA bus routes serving the area, connecting you to the Blue Line and Green Line 'L' trains for broader city access. O'Hare International Airport (ORD) is the closest major airport, generally a 20-30 minute drive depending on traffic. Midway International Airport (MDW) is also accessible, typically taking 30-40 minutes by car. Rideshare services and taxis are readily available, but it's advisable to allow extra travel time during rush hours or major city events to ensure timely arrival.

Garfield Park Conservatory
The Garfield Park Conservatory is a stunning botanical haven, offering a tranquil escape with a vast collection of exotic plants from around the world. Its diverse climate-controlled rooms, including a desert house, tropical house, and show house, provide a unique educational and visually stimulating experience year-round. It's a perfect destination for a contemplative visit or a memorable outing, especially on cooler or inclement weather days. Allow at least an hour to explore its impressive botanical displays.

Weather & Seasons at Austin BUS & Entrepreneurship Hs
- Winter: Expect cold temperatures, often dropping below freezing, with possibilities of snow and icy conditions. Layers are essential, including heavy coats, hats, gloves, and waterproof boots. Travel can be slower due to snow, and outdoor activities are limited, making indoor attractions more appealing. Allow extra time for commutes and be prepared for chilly walks between locations.
- Spring & early summer: Temperatures gradually warm, ranging from cool to pleasantly mild. Pack light layers such as sweaters or jackets for cooler evenings and breezy days. Outdoor activities become more viable, but occasional rain showers are frequent, so an umbrella is a good idea. Comfortable walking shoes are recommended for exploring the area.
- Mid-summer: Summers are typically warm to hot and can be humid, with average temperatures in the 70s and 80s Fahrenheit. Lightweight clothing like t-shirts, shorts, and light dresses are ideal. Sunscreen, hats, and sunglasses are necessary for daytime outings. Hydration is key, and evenings can still offer a bit of a cool breeze.
- Fall season: Fall offers crisp, cool air, transitioning from mild to cold as the season progresses. Light jackets, sweaters, and long pants are standard. As temperatures drop, heavier outerwear may be needed, especially in the later weeks. It’s a beautiful time for walking, with colorful foliage in local parks.
- Rain & snow: Chicago experiences significant rainfall, particularly in spring and summer, and snowfall throughout winter. Always check the forecast before heading out; rain gear and umbrellas are advisable during wet periods. Winter necessitates warm, waterproof boots and layers to combat snow and cold. Be mindful of slick surfaces and potential travel disruptions due to weather.
